Put on therefore, as the elect of God, holy and beloved, bowels of mercies, kindness, humbleness of mind, meekness, longsuffering; forbearing one another, and forgiving one another, if any man have a quarrel against any: even as Christ forgave you, so also do ye. And above all these things put on charity, which is the bond of perfectness.
Colossians 3:12-14 

Behold, I send you forth as sheep in the midst of wolves; be ye therefore wise as serpents, and harmless as doves.
Matthew 10:16 

Thoughts on Today's Verse...
The dove has been a symbol of Christianity since its early stages, and has several representations. It depicts the presence of the Holy Spirit, who descended upon Jesus, as described in the Gospels. But the dove is also a symbol of peace and forgiveness, as it relates to the story of Noah near the end of the flood: "When the dove returned to him in the evening, there in its beak was a freshly plucked olive leaf!" (Genesis 8:11 )
This peaceful dove, the Holy Spirit, gentle but no less powerful, is able to produce the qualities mentioned in today's Scripture, if we will yield our lives to Him. Through the Spirit's power, we may be wise yet harmless.
We are to be clothed not only with the garment of salvation but also with the garments of love and Christian service, as Jesus commands us: "Be dressed ready for service."(Luke 12:35) Then, we may be a light sent forth to shine in this lost and dark world.

Not only so, but we also rejoice in our sufferings, because we know that suffering produces perseverance; perseverance, character; and character, hope. And hope does not disappoint us, because God has poured out his love into our hearts by the Holy Spirit, whom he has given us. 
Romans 5:3-5 

Thoughts on Today's Verse...
Most of us do not like suffering. When our life takes a turn from the normal, we often end up acting out. We may yowl and holler in frustration as we rail against the situation. When this doesn't bring the desired change, bad temper and pity parties may make their entrance, followed by a stage of plea bargaining with God to open the doors of whatever suffering has us confined within such an intolerable situation.
We read our Bible more. We pray continually. We do every good act of mercy we can manage, yet still, the constraint of suffering is not lifted.
Perhaps, it's because the journey is not yet over, a journey which God has allowed us to embark upon that we might become larger -- more mature people -- spiritually.
